What are the 5 most common causes of car accidents in New Jersey?

Below are the most common causes of car accidents in New Jersey:

  1. Speeding while driving: Increased numbers of fatal car accidents have been a result of speeding. However, in most cases, crashes could be evaded completely if people drove the speed limit. Speeding narrows a driver’s ability to maintain control of their vehicle. In order to ensure you are driving safely, be conscious of the speed limit at all times.
  2. Texting while driving: People have been more dependant and addicted to their mobile devices and technology recently. Using your phone while driving can result in drastic life-threatening results.
  3. Drinking and driving: Alcohol is one of the largest causes of car accidents each day. A person’s ability to carefully drive their car falls drastically after they’ve had alcohol. Drinking and driving is never worth it for both legal and safety reasons.
  4. Distractions while driving: Fiddling around with the center console of your car to adjust settings or to change the radio channel can make you take your eyes off of the road. These disruptions can have detrimental consequences. Be sure to keep your eyes on the road and limit as many distractions as possible when operating your vehicle.
  5. Weather conditions: The chances of getting into an accident increase when the weather is bad. Rain, snow, and ice can cause the roads to be slippery, which can result in the possibility of losing control of your vehicle. Be an attentive driver when the weather is bad, and if you are able to, stay off the roads.

Can I file a personal injury claim after a car accident in New Jersey?

You may be entitled to compensation if you were injured in a car accident as a result of another driver’s negligence.
